Getting there
748 Fourth Line West, Sault Ste. Marie
From Sault Ste. Marie, take Highway 17 North along Lake Superior to Wawa, then continue toward White River. From there, take Highway 631 North to Tukanee Lake for a 40-minute flight with White River Air, or continue to Hornepayne for a 20-minute flight with Forde Lake Air Service. Transfers to the camps are made exclusively by floatplane (Beaver or Otter).

Good to know
Garson’s Fly-In Outposts offers fishing trips and moose hunting at remote camps in the heart of the Nagagami Forest in Northern Ontario. Operated by Bob and Andrea Garson, the outfitter features two isolated camps located on Lascelles and Little Kaby Lakes. Anglers can target walleye, northern pike, yellow perch, and whitefish. The establishment also offers moose hunting in Unit 22, accessible exclusively by air.
The territory is located in the heart of the Nagagami Forest in Northern Ontario. It centers around two distinct bodies of water, accessible only by air. Lascelles Lake, located 52 miles northeast of White River, is a 4-mile-long rocky lake with five inlets and one creek. Little Kaby Lake, 46 miles northeast of White River, covers 3,095 acres and stretches 7 miles long, characterized by weed beds, rocky shores, and an island.
